Good Grief Hastings brought people together over the late May Bank Holiday weekend to explore grief, love and loss through creativity, conversation and community. Across four days, hundreds of people came together for talks, workshops, performances, exhibitions, music, storytelling and shared experiences. From sold-out events to quiet moments of reflection, the festival created welcoming spaces where people could connect, remember, create and discover new ways of talking about grief.

This short film captures some of the people, moments and conversations that made Good Grief Hastings so special. Produced by Sussex-based events organisation 18 Hours, in partnership with St Michael’s Hospice, Good Grief Festival CIC and the University of Brighton, Good Grief Hastings formed part of the national Coastal Community and Creative Health research project, exploring how creativity can strengthen wellbeing, reduce isolation and support healthier communities.
